Calf Injury Controversy Escalates: Pakistan Opener Imam-ul-Haq Poised for Legal Battle Against PCB's 'Fake Injury' Probe

Pakistan's prominent opening batsman, Imam-ul-Haq, is reportedly preparing to engage legal counsel to contest an urgent investigation initiated by the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) into a calf injury he sustained during the recent Test series against England. The high-stakes inquiry comes amidst mounting allegations from former cricketers and resurfacing past claims suggesting the player may have feigned his ailment, thrusting the cricket star into a significant disciplinary challenge. In a dramatic turn of events, Pakistan's opening batsman Imam-ul-Haq is reportedly gearing up for a legal confrontation, intending to challenge an urgent investigation launched by the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) concerning a contentious calf injury he sustained during the second Test against England.

Background Context & Core Story

The controversy first erupted when Imam-ul-Haq, after reporting a 'tear' in his calf muscle while fielding during England's first innings, did not participate in either of Pakistan's batting innings. Medical sources initially suggested a recovery period of ten days. However, the narrative took a sharp turn on the fourth day of the Test when Imam was observed performing 'uncomfortable throwdowns' with a patch on his calf, prompting an instruction for him to withdraw to the dressing room. This incident fueled widespread speculation, with several former cricketers publicly suggesting that the injury might not be genuine, leading to allegations of 'faking' the ailment.
